HST 4080. Indigenous Communities in Asia (3 credits) This course focuses on the history of Uyghur, Tibetan, Mongolian communities in Asia, as well as specific indigenous groups in Japan and South East Asia. Some of the topics explored are the intersection of gender and local identity within these communities, in conjunction with the formation of specific Asian nation states during the nineteenth and twentieth centuries. The course also aims to help students at UNCP to find and explore the historical experiences of indigenous people in other parts of the world. PREREQ/COREQ: HST 3000 or Instructor Permission
